What are the most common auto repairs needed for vehicles in the Ramsey, Illinois area?

Due to our rural roads and seasonal temperature extremes, common repairs include suspension components (shocks/struts), brake work, and battery replacements. Winter road treatments also lead to frequent exhaust and undercarriage corrosion, while summer heat can strain cooling systems and air conditioning.

Are auto repair prices in Ramsey generally higher or lower than in larger cities like Vandalia or Effingham?

Labor rates in Ramsey are often more competitive than in larger regional cities, offering potential savings. However, for specialized parts, local shops may have slightly higher part markups or longer wait times due to the need for ordering, as they don't have the immediate wholesale access of bigger markets.

When should I seek service for my check engine light around Ramsey?

Seek service promptly, as driving on rural routes with an unresolved issue could lead to a breakdown far from assistance. Many local shops can perform a quick diagnostic scan to determine if it's a minor sensor issue or something urgent like an emissions control problem critical for passing Illinois state inspections.

What local factors should I consider when maintaining my car in Ramsey?

Prepare your vehicle for heavy seasonal demands: ensure winter readiness with antifreeze and battery checks, and summer readiness with coolant system service. Frequent travel on gravel or chip-and-seal roads means you should regularly check tire pressure, alignment, and windshield integrity for stone chips.
